Introduction & Background

I am an engineer with 4 years experience working in technology. I have primarily worked on the Development, but have worked across a broad range of technologies there on: Python, Django, Shell Scripting and most recently ML. As well as spending a reasonable amount of time building applications for the web, which has given me an exposure to a range of javascript technologies over the years, through jQuery and most recently to React.

I enjoy building interesting products, with a good Product Management focus and a good emphasis on good engineering principles and clean code (having worked across differing languages on the PVM, I recognise that good code is contextual).


Areas of experience & interest

Python   Django   HTML   CSS   JS   JQuery   Ajax   SQL   REST   Technical Architecture   Machine learning   Server Administation   Network Administation   Survilance CCTV Administarion  

Work Experience


Some projects I am Working On

Additional Information

Django Developer: My current role uses Django as the primary language and have been building applications in Python for the last one years. I am familiar with a range of Python libraries, such as Django Library and Data Science Library, as well as familiar with a range of functional programming techniques available.

Cloud platforms: I have primarily used AWS for running production apps on the cloud. I have experience setting up, configuring and running applications using a range of AWS offerings, including EC2, RDS, S3, Cogito, Lambda and its more recent Machine Learning capabilities.

Web Development: Through building web applications, I have also worked with various client side technology, having used jQuery, Bootstrap, LESS, SASS, Backbone/Underscore/Require. More recently I have written React applications (primarily using the Create React App framework, and extending them)

Development Control: I have a good knowledge of application life-cycle management and have worked with SVN, Git, Jenkins etc. I have experience with an array of testing tools and technologies.

I have also gained experience and knowledge of other technologies from several side projects and research that I have undertaken in my free time, including Forntend, a variety of social APIs (Twitter etc) and cloud platforms such as GPC/Alibaba/AWS.

I write a blog covering technical and opinion articles that can be found here: ravishankersingh19.blogspot.com/ (I am also a DZone)

StackOverflow Flair

Recent blog posts